What is the definition of a real number?

Back

A real number is any value that represents a quantity along a continuous line, including all rational and irrational numbers.

What is the set of natural numbers (N)?

Back

The set of natural numbers includes all positive integers starting from 1: N = {1, 2, 3, ...}.

What is the set of integers (Z)?

Back

The set of integers includes all whole numbers, both positive and negative, as well as zero: Z = {..., -3, -2, -1, 0, 1, 2, 3, ...}.

What is the set of rational numbers (Q)?

Back

The set of rational numbers includes all numbers that can be expressed as a fraction of two integers, where the denominator is not zero.

What is the x-intercept of a linear equation?

Back

The x-intercept is the point where the graph of the equation crosses the x-axis, found by setting y = 0 and solving for x.

How do you solve a compound inequality?

Back

To solve a compound inequality, isolate the variable in the middle and express the solution as a range of values.

What is interval notation?

Back

Interval notation is a way of writing subsets of the real number line using parentheses and brackets to indicate whether endpoints are included.
